private string GetValue(string key)
{
return GetValue(key, String.Empty);
}
private bool GetValueBoolean(string key, bool defaultValue = false)
{
return Convert.ToBoolean(GetValue(key, defaultValue));
}
private int GetValueInt(string key, int defaultValue = 0)
{
return Convert.ToInt32(GetValue(key, defaultValue));
}
public T GetValueEnum<T>(string key, T defaultValue)
{
return (T)Enum.Parse(typeof(T), GetValue(key, defaultValue), true);
}
public string GetValue(string key, object defaultValue, bool persist = false)
{
key = key.ToLowerInvariant();
Ensure.That(key, () => key).IsNotNullOrWhiteSpace();
EnsureCache();
string dbValue;
if (_cache.TryGetValue(key, out dbValue) && dbValue != null && !String.IsNullOrEmpty(dbValue))
return dbValue;
_logger.Trace("Unable to find config key '{0}' defaultValue:'{1}'", key, defaultValue);
if (persist)
{
SetValue(key, defaultValue.ToString());
}
return defaultValue.ToString();
}
private void SetValue(string key, Boolean value)
{
SetValue(key, value.ToString());
}
private void SetValue(string key, int value)
{
SetValue(key, value.ToString());
}
public void SetValue(string key, string value)
{
key = key.ToLowerInvariant();
_logger.Trace("Writing Setting to database. Key:'{0}' Value:'{1}'", key, value);
var dbValue = _repository.Get(key);
if (dbValue == null)
{
_repository.Insert(new Config { Key = key, Value = value });
}
else
{
dbValue.Value = value;
_repository.Update(dbValue);
}
ClearCache();
}
public void SetValue(string key, Enum value)
{
SetValue(key, value.ToString().ToLower());
}
private void EnsureCache()
{
lock (_cache)
{
if (!_cache.Any())
{
_cache = All().ToDictionary(c => c.Key.ToLower(), c => c.Value);
}
}
}
public static void ClearCache()
{
lock (_cache)
{
_cache = new Dictionary<string, string>();
}
}
